The Paid Search Specialist is a digital marketing professional responsible for planning, executing, and optimizing p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ns across search engines such as Google Ads and Microsoft Advertising. This role is critical within the marketing team, directly impacting lead generation, online sales, and brand visibility. The Paid Search Specialist collaborates closely with other digital marketers, content creators, and analytics teams to ensure campaigns align with broader marketing objectives and deliver measurable ROI.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op, implement, and manage paid search campaigns across platforms like Google Ads and Microsoft Advertising.
- Conduct keyword research, ad copywriting, and audience targeting to maximize campaign performance.
- Monitor, analyze, and report on campaign metrics, providing actionable insights and recommendations for optimization.
- Manage budgets, bid strategies, and pacing to ensure efficient spend and achievement of KPIs.
- Perform A/B testing on ad creatives, landing pages, and targeting strategies to improve conversion rates.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to align paid search efforts with overall marketing strategies and initiatives.
- Stay current with industry trends, search engine updates, and best practices to maintain competitive advantage.
- Ensure campaigns comply with platform policies and brand guidelines.
- Utilize analytics tools (e.g., Google Analytics, Data Studio) to track performance and generate regular reports for stakeholders.
